Advanced search

TW11 8PB sold prices

Church Road includes TW11 8PB , TW11 8PF , TW11 8PY .
Price trends | Analysis of TW11 8

Last sold Price paid Floor area (m²) Floor area (sq ft) £ per m² £ per sq ft Type Sold sq ft £/m² £/sq ft
Church Road Studios, 30, Church Road, Teddington, TW11 8PB 09 May 2025 £3,225,000 B 427 4596 sqft £7,552 £701 Other
26, Church Road, Teddington, TW11 8PB - photos available 24 Oct 2024 £810,000 82 882 sqft £9,878 £917 Terrace (2 bed)
10a, Church Road, Teddington, TW11 8PB 09 Feb 2024 £245,000 B 47 505 sqft £5,212 £484 Other (2 bed)
36, Church Road, Teddington, TW11 8PB 03 Apr 2023 £490,000 54 581 sqft £9,074 £843 Flat
22, Church Road, Teddington, TW11 8PB - photos available 06 Jan 2023 £1,100,000 111 1194 sqft £9,909 £920 Terrace (3 bed)
Flat 1 4, Church Road, Teddington, TW11 8PB - photos available 28 Oct 2022 £450,000 62 667 sqft £7,258 £674 Flat (2 bed)
38, Church Road, Teddington, TW11 8PB - photos available 21 Jun 2022 £840,000 90 968 sqft £9,333 £867 Terrace (3 bed)
44, Church Road, Teddington, TW11 8PB 24 Jun 2021 £640,000 B Other
Flat 3 4, Church Road, Teddington, TW11 8PB - photos available 18 May 2021 £365,000 61 656 sqft £5,983 £555 Flat (2 bed)
50, Church Road, Teddington, TW11 8PB - photos available 04 Dec 2020 £975,000 138 1485 sqft £7,065 £656 Semi-D (3 bed)
40, Church Road, Teddington, TW11 8PB - photos available 03 Sep 2020 £925,000 142 1528 sqft £6,514 £605 Terrace (3 bed)
28, Church Road, Teddington, TW11 8PB - photos available 07 Jul 2020 £1,550,000 181 1948 sqft £8,563 £795 Semi-D (4 bed)
Flat 6 4, Church Road, Teddington, TW11 8PB - photos available 16 Dec 2019 £390,000 54 581 sqft £7,222 £670 Flat (2 bed)
10, Church Road, Teddington, TW11 8PB 29 Mar 2017 £35,000 B Other
42, Church Road, Teddington, TW11 8PB - photos available 24 May 2016 £935,000 142 1528 sqft £6,584 £611 Terrace (3 bed)
Flat 2 4, Church Road, Teddington, TW11 8PB 30 Mar 2016 £386,000 B 61 656 sqft £6,327 £587 Flat (2 bed)
Flat 4 4, Church Road, Teddington, TW11 8PB - photos available 19 Aug 2013 £287,000 64 688 sqft £4,484 £416 Flat (2 bed)
48, Church Road, Teddington, TW11 8PB - photos available 22 Jan 2013 £770,000 144 1550 sqft £5,347 £496 Terrace (3 bed)
24, Church Road, Teddington, TW11 8PB - photos available 10 Sep 2012 £520,000 67 721 sqft £7,761 £721 Terrace (3 bed)
16, Church Road, Teddington, TW11 8PB - photos available 12 Mar 2012 £506,000 104 1119 sqft £4,865 £451 Terrace (3 bed)
12b, Church Road, Teddington, TW11 8PB 03 Jan 2008 £223,000 45 484 sqft £4,955 £460 Flat
12a, Church Road, Teddington, TW11 8PB - photos available 19 Sep 2007 £235,000 39 419 sqft £6,025 £559 Flat
Flat 2 8, Church Road, Teddington, TW11 8PB - photos available 01 Feb 2007 £210,000 50 538 sqft £4,200 £390 Flat
Flat 1 8, Church Road, Teddington, TW11 8PB 01 Feb 2007 £195,000 34 365 sqft £5,735 £532 Flat
The Ground Floor Flat At 40, Church Road, Teddington, TW11 8PB 05 Jan 2007 £203,000 Flat
10, Church Road, Teddington, TW11 8PB 08 Aug 2006 £315,000 Terrace
6a, Church Road, Teddington, TW11 8PB - photos available 06 Apr 2006 £180,000 50 538 sqft £3,600 £334 Flat (2 bed)
36a, Church Road, Teddington, TW11 8PB - photos available 10 Mar 2006 £226,000 60 645 sqft £3,766 £349 Flat
Flat 1 6, Church Road, Teddington, TW11 8PB 31 Mar 2004 £302,000 Terrace
The Ground Floor Flat At 40, Church Road, Teddington, TW11 8PB 23 Apr 2002 £160,000 Flat
Church Road Studios, 30, Church Rd £3,225,000 B
May-2025
427 4596 7,552 701
26, Church Rd - photos available £810,000
Oct-2024
82 882 9,878 917
10a, Church Rd £245,000 B
Feb-2024
47 505 5,212 484
36, Church Rd £490,000
Apr-2023
54 581 9,074 843
22, Church Rd - photos available £1,100,000
Jan-2023
111 1194 9,909 920
Flat 1 4, Church Rd - photos available £450,000
Oct-2022
62 667 7,258 674
38, Church Rd - photos available £840,000
Jun-2022
90 968 9,333 867
44, Church Rd £640,000 B
Jun-2021
Flat 3 4, Church Rd - photos available £365,000
May-2021
61 656 5,983 555
50, Church Rd - photos available £975,000
Dec-2020
138 1485 7,065 656
40, Church Rd - photos available £925,000
Sep-2020
142 1528 6,514 605
28, Church Rd - photos available £1,550,000
Jul-2020
181 1948 8,563 795
Flat 6 4, Church Rd - photos available £390,000
Dec-2019
54 581 7,222 670
10, Church Rd £35,000 B
Mar-2017
42, Church Rd - photos available £935,000
May-2016
142 1528 6,584 611
Flat 2 4, Church Rd £386,000 B
Mar-2016
61 656 6,327 587
Flat 4 4, Church Rd - photos available £287,000
Aug-2013
64 688 4,484 416
48, Church Rd - photos available £770,000
Jan-2013
144 1550 5,347 496
24, Church Rd - photos available £520,000
Sep-2012
67 721 7,761 721
16, Church Rd - photos available £506,000
Mar-2012
104 1119 4,865 451
12b, Church Rd £223,000
Jan-2008
45 484 4,955 460
12a, Church Rd - photos available £235,000
Sep-2007
39 419 6,025 559
Flat 2 8, Church Rd - photos available £210,000
Feb-2007
50 538 4,200 390
Flat 1 8, Church Rd £195,000
Feb-2007
34 365 5,735 532
The Ground Floor Flat At 40, Church Rd £203,000
Jan-2007
10, Church Rd £315,000
Aug-2006
6a, Church Rd - photos available £180,000
Apr-2006
50 538 3,600 334
36a, Church Rd - photos available £226,000
Mar-2006
60 645 3,766 349
Flat 1 6, Church Rd £302,000
Mar-2004
The Ground Floor Flat At 40, Church Rd £160,000
Apr-2002

The data above for Church Road can be visualised as a scatter graph, this will show price trends over time.

The average price per square metre (per square foot) in Church Road, Teddington is £8,765 sqm (£814 per sq ft), this is from sold property prices of the 6 most recent sales.
The majority of homes in Teddington are now selling for between £6,730 and £9,150 per square metre (£625 and £850 per square foot) , find out more in this local analysis of TW11 8 (Teddington) house prices.
There are roughly 41 homes on Church Road, we would have expected about 5 sales each year given that in the UK people sell their homes on average once every 7 years.
In the last 4 years there have been 6 property sales in Church Road, averaging approximately 1 home sales per year .
The average size of all the properties on Church Road is 83 m2 (893 sqft).